New look for the YMCA
Posted: 09.06.2011 at 4:52 PM
|
KIRKSVILLE, MO -- The Adair County Family YMCA looks a lot different inside.
It received eight new treadmills, six ellipticals, two bikes, two stair steppers and a strength training circuit set from the company Precore.
All of the treadmills arrived in crates and the Precore team assembled them in the gym. The Kirksville Police Department disassembled and carried out the old strength training equipment. The entire renovation process took about fifteen hours.
The YMCA worked on renovations in the child care areas as well as in the aerobics room. A new space was also created for the spinning classes.
Executive Director Sarah Riffer said, "We're hoping that we help each member or potential new members meet their individual goals or lifestyle."
So far everyone who has used the new equipment loves it.
